Place a throwaway directory in /opt/lmi/, not in /tmp/
See:
https://lists.nongnu.org/archive/html/lmi/2019-05/msg00029.html
To a native msw program running under cygwin, '/tmp' is something like
D:\tmp
whereas to cygwin itself, '/tmp' is something like
D:\cygwin64-lmi\tmp
. To avoid that unwanted contrariety, placed the throwaway directory
under /opt/lmi/ so that the cygwin "identity mount" maps both to the
same place.
Full paths seem preferable because of their unambiguity. For example, if
$PERFORM /opt/lmi/bin/lmi_cli_shared --file="$throwaway_dir"/X.ill
is echoed into a nychthemeral log as
wine /opt/lmi/bin/lmi_cli_shared --file=/opt/lmi/amd64/logs/tmp/X.ill
and that command fails, then it can be copied and pasted into a terminal
to be run manually without adjusting the terminal's $PWD.
